2517 Squadron Ct Virginia Beach, VA 23453
This exceptional industrial property in Virginia Beach, VA, offers a total of 20,800 square feet of warehouse and manufacturing space. Currently, 4,400 square feet is immediately available for lease, representing a fantastic opportunity for businesses seeking a versatile and functional space. The property is situated at 2517 Squadron Ct, Virginia Beach, VA 23453, offering convenient access to key transportation routes. The building features multiple tenancies, allowing for flexibility in space requirements. The available unit offers a minimum divisible space of 4,400 square feet, ideal for a variety of operations. The space includes grade-level loading with 10' wide by 10' high doors, ensuring efficient loading and unloading of goods. This property is perfect for businesses needing both warehouse storage and manufacturing capabilities, providing a strategic location in a thriving Virginia Beach industrial area. The property's size and layout provide ample room for expansion or adaptation to suit specific business needs. Interested parties are encouraged to inquire about lease terms and availability. The property is classified as industrial, with warehouse and manufacturing subtypes.
